Implementing an effective rainwater collection system requires careful planning and consideration of various factors to ensure optimal performance and utility.
A well-designed system typically comprises a series of components, including channels to direct rainwater from rooftops, holding containers to store the collected water, and filtration systems to remove debris and contaminants. The choice of materials and system design should match with the specific needs and conditions of your property.
- Assess your roof size and inclination to determine the potential for rainwater collection.
- Select appropriate storage tanks based on your water requirements and available space.
- Employ filtration systems to ensure the collected water is safe for various applications, such as gardening or non-potable internal functions.

Easy Strategies for Capturing Rooftop Runoff
Harnessing the power of rooftop runoff can be a straightforward way to conserve water and reduce your environmental impact.
One common strategy is installing rain barrels to collect rainwater from downspouts. These affordable containers can contain hundreds of gallons of water, which can then be used for moistening your garden or washing your patio.
Another useful option is creating a rain garden. This element to your landscape captures runoff and filters it naturally before it enters the sewer system.
To enhance your runoff capture efforts, consider:
- Direct downspouts to barrels or rain gardens.
- Employ permeable paving materials in areas where runoff accumulates.
- Opt for landscaping that soaks up water effectively.
